Hewlett-Packard has announced the HP HDX16 and HDX18 entertainment notebook PCs, featuring high-definition playback support, built-in TV tuners, Blu-ray technology, and a new chassis design.
“The HDX16 is a midsize notebook with a 16-inch diagonal widescreen with 720- or 1,080-pixel resolution display. The HDX18 is a powerful and visually captivating full-size notebook with an 18.4-inch diagonal Ultra BrightView 1,080-pixel screen and enthusiast-class graphics capabilities,” HP explains.
The both laptops also include Altec Lansing speakers, an HP Triple Bass subwoofer, and Dolby Home Theater software.
The HP HDX16 and HDX18 start at $1,299 and $1,549 respectively. The PC maker said the notebooks are expected to be available starting later this month. However, the HDX16t model is on sale now.
